    I have a problem with the Thinkpad X carbon 1 in which I can get resolution of 1920 x 1080 on my external monitor (capable of 2560 x 1440), when connected via HDMI using among Dock port but when I connect via direct X carbon 1 display port, I can get the full resolution I want. I've updated the firmware of the docking station Onelink and the pilot video X 1 carbon, what can I do else? Any thoughts?

    Thanks in advance!

    On OneLink port hdmi port is hdmi 1.3 only, so it doesn't support resolution qhd. You should get the dock pro OneLink with its integrated displayport.

    My concern is that when the laptop is fully charged when you are connected to the dock, is it possible to switch to the battery while remaining connected to the docking station in order to use the monitor extrnal, ethernet and usb ports etc?

    What I noticed is that even when the battery is charged to 100%, the dock guard charge that the battery does not fall below 100% and in the long term it will reduce the battery life.

    Thank you.

    eddie_313 wrote:

    What I noticed is that even when the battery is charged to 100%, the dock guard charge that the battery does not fall below 100% and in the long term it will reduce the battery life.

    1. go on ThinkVantage Power Manager.

    2. click on the tab of the battery, then battery maintenance.

    3. in the load Mode section select custom load threshold.

    4 set the thresholds to start charging when below for example 40% and stop loading with for example 80%.

    I did it on my X12C with docking station OneL:ink. I know it works because it stops the battery to the superior threhold. Then, I can see the charge decrease slowly over time to the low threshold.
